Exploring the Benefits of Prefabricated Truss Bridges in Electrical Infrastructure
Prefabricated truss bridges are becoming an increasingly popular choice for various applications in the electrical industry, especially in the realm of transmission and distribution systems. These structures, designed for efficient assembly and durability, offer a range of benefits that make them well-suited for supporting electrical equipment and components.
One of the primary advantages of prefabricated truss bridges is their rapid installation. These bridges are manufactured off-site and can be transported to the construction location for quick assembly. This feature is particularly beneficial for electrical projects that require minimal downtime and swift completion, ensuring that electrical infrastructure can be established with efficiency and precision.
Additionally, prefabricated truss bridges are engineered to handle heavy loads, making them ideal for supporting electrical equipment such as transformers, switchgear, and other critical components. Their robust design ensures that they can withstand the stresses and strains associated with electrical operations, providing a reliable platform for various applications. This aspect is crucial in maintaining the safety and functionality of electrical systems, especially in remote or challenging environments.
Another key benefit of these bridges is their adaptability. The modular nature of prefabricated truss bridges allows for customization to meet specific project requirements. Whether accommodating different spans, loads, or site conditions, these bridges can be tailored to suit the needs of electrical infrastructure projects. This versatility ensures that they can be effectively integrated into a variety of settings, from urban landscapes to rural areas.
Sustainability is also a significant consideration in modern electrical infrastructure projects. Prefabricated truss bridges often utilize materials that are both environmentally friendly and durable, resulting in structures that minimize environmental impact over their lifespan. Their efficient construction process reduces waste, and many materials can be recycled, aligning with the growing emphasis on sustainable development in the electrical sector.
Moreover, the use of prefabricated truss bridges can enhance the overall safety of electrical installations. Their design allows for clear spans without the need for intrusive support structures, which can minimize potential hazards associated with electrical lines and equipment. By providing unobstructed pathways, these bridges contribute to safer working environments for electrical professionals.
In conclusion, prefabricated truss bridges represent an innovative solution for the electrical industry, particularly in the context of supporting transmission and distribution equipment. With their rapid installation, robust design, adaptability, and sustainability, they offer a multitude of benefits that can significantly enhance the efficiency and safety of electrical infrastructure projects. As the industry continues to evolve, the integration of such advanced structures will undoubtedly play a crucial role in shaping the future of electrical systems.
